The introduction, in 1846, of NaOH as a solid base titrant prolonged acid–base titrimetry for the determination of weak acids. The synthesis of organic and natural dyes supplied a lot of new indicators. Phenolphthalein, as an example, was initial synthesized by Bayer in 1871 and applied being an indicator for acid–base titrations in 1877.
